The utility model discloses a theory of operation is:
the utility model relates to a full-automatic powder spraying reciprocating machine device, which is suitable for various powder spraying reciprocating occasions, when in use, a powder spraying piece is placed in a placing groove on a conveyor belt 5, and the powder spraying piece is subjected to powder spraying operation through a powder spraying box 19; in the powder spraying process, the exhaust fan 11 acts in the powder storage box 10, powder in the powder storage box 10 is conveyed into the powder spraying box 19 through the adsorption pipe 9 and the elastic pipe 14, the powder spraying pieces on the conveying belt 5 are filtered and sprayed through the filter plate 21 and the powder spraying head 22 in the powder spraying box 19, in the powder spraying process, the forward and reverse rotation sensors 25 at the left end and the right end of the reciprocating screw rod 27 transmit signals to the controller, so that the forward and reverse rotation of the reciprocating motor 12 is controlled, the reciprocating screw rod 27 further drives the powder spraying box 19 to integrally perform left and right reciprocating motion, and the left and right powder spraying treatment on the powder spraying pieces can improve the working reliability.
